Garlic Parmesan Air Fryer Carrot Fries Ingredients

For the Fries
Carrots – Fresh carrots will provide the best sweetness and texture; avoid frozen.
Olive Oil – This helps ensure crispiness; substitute with garlic-infused oil for extra flavor.
Garlic (crushed) – Adds a wonderful aroma and flavor; garlic powder works well in a pinch.

For the Topping
Reduced Fat Grated Parmesan – Keep the calories low while enjoying that cheesy goodness; regular Parmesan or nutritional yeast are great dairy-free options.
Crushed Red Pepper (optional) – Introduces a hint of heat; omit if you prefer a milder taste.
Freshly Cracked Black Pepper (optional) – Enhances the overall flavor; it’s optional but recommended for seasoning.

How to Make Garlic Parmesan Air Fryer Carrot Fries

  1. Prepare Garlic Oil: Begin by combining the crushed garlic with olive oil in a small bowl. This mixture will not only enhance the flavor but also help achieve that desired crispiness!

  2. Prep Carrots: Wash and dry your fresh carrots, then cut them into fry-sized sticks. Aim for uniform thickness to ensure even cooking—this is crucial for that perfect texture!

  3. Coat Carrots: Toss the carrot fries in the garlic oil mixture, ensuring they’re well-coated. This step is essential for maximizing flavor and achieving that delectable crunch.

  4. Season: In a separate bowl, mix the reduced-fat Parmesan with any optional spices you’d like to add. Sprinkle half of this mixture over the carrots, toss them well, and then repeat with the remaining seasoning.

  5. Air Fry: Place the seasoned carrot fries in the air fryer basket, making sure they’re in a single layer for optimal airflow. Set your air fryer to 350°F and cook for about 16-20 minutes, shaking the basket halfway through to promote even cooking.

  6. Garnish: Once they’re crispy and golden-brown, remove the fries from the air fryer and sprinkle fresh parsley on top for a burst of color and freshness!

Optional: Serve with a side of sriracha yogurt for a zesty dipping experience.

Expert Tips for Garlic Parmesan Air Fryer Carrot Fries

Use Fresh Carrots: Fresh carrots yield a sweeter, firmer texture. Avoid frozen varieties which can result in mushy fries.

Ensure Even Coating: Thoroughly coat the fries with garlic oil to achieve that perfect crispiness. Clumps can lead to uneven cooking.

Monitor Cooking Time: Every air fryer cooks differently. Keep an eye on the fries to avoid overcooking; adjustment may be needed based on your model.

Single Layer Cooking: Make sure the carrot fries are arranged in a single layer for optimal airflow and crispness in your Garlic Parmesan Air Fryer Carrot Fries.

How to Store and Freeze Garlic Parmesan Air Fryer Carrot Fries

  • Room Temperature: These carrot fries are best enjoyed fresh out of the air fryer; avoid leaving them at room temperature for more than 2 hours to ensure safety.
  • Fridge: Store any leftover Garlic Parmesan Air Fryer Carrot Fries in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. Reheat for best crispiness.
  • Freezer: For longer storage, freeze the fries in a single layer on a baking sheet, then transfer to a freezer bag. They can be frozen for up to 2 months.
  • Reheating: Reheat from frozen in the air fryer at 350°F for about 10-12 minutes or until heated through and crispy. Enjoy the same delicious flavor once again!

What if my carrot fries are soggy?
If your carrot fries turn out soggy, it’s likely due to excess moisture. Make sure to wash and dry your carrots thoroughly before cutting them. Also, ensure they are evenly coated with the garlic oil mixture and placed in a single layer in the air fryer. If overcrowded, they’ll steam instead of crisping up.

Ingredients
  

For the Fries
  • 4 carrots Fresh Carrots Avoid frozen.
  • 1 tablespoon Olive Oil Substitute with garlic-infused oil for extra flavor.
  • 2 cloves Garlic (crushed) Garlic powder works well in a pinch.
For the Topping
  • 1/2 cup Reduced Fat Grated Parmesan Regular Parmesan or nutritional yeast are great dairy-free options.
  • 1/4 teaspoon Crushed Red Pepper (optional) Omit if you prefer a milder taste.
  • 1/4 teaspoon Freshly Cracked Black Pepper (optional) It's optional but recommended for seasoning.

Equipment

  • Air Fryer

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Begin by combining the crushed garlic with olive oil in a small bowl.
  2. Wash and dry your fresh carrots, then cut them into fry-sized sticks.
  3. Toss the carrot fries in the garlic oil mixture, ensuring they're well-coated.
  4. In a separate bowl, mix the reduced-fat Parmesan with any optional spices and sprinkle half over the carrots.
  5. Place the seasoned carrot fries in the air fryer basket and cook at 350°F for about 16-20 minutes.
  6. Once crispy and golden-brown, remove the fries from the air fryer and sprinkle fresh parsley on top.
